We stayed there 4 nights in an executive suite and found the room very spacious, looked recently renovated. The bathroom was huge with double sinks a walk-in shower and a huge soaker bath that we made use of. Bring your own bath salts or bubble bath, non are supplied. We found the bed comfortable. Our room had a view of the carpark with mountains in the distance which was not great, but it was on the 3rd floor so did not expect much. We just closed the curtains and you wouldn't know. Nice large TV.
We did not try the breakfast but did have dinner at the Brazilian restaurant which did offer a decent discount for hotel residents and was a very nice dinner. The location was very good. The boat marina was just down the road, the Esplanade was right there as was many coffee shops and restaurants of varying types and prices, all within short walking distances. All in all we found it a very pleasant stay.

One of the worst hotels we’ve ever stayed in. We booked the deluxe king with balcony, and the moment we set foot in reception, we knew it was a mistake. The reception area was very tired looking, toilets were not easily accessible and they were very dirty. The lift and corridors were old and dirty. Our room itself was very dirty, obviously hadn’t had a thorough clean in what looked like years. The toilet seat was bubbled and broken, there were stains/marks in the toilet bowl, hair on the floor. The shower was extremely slippery and dangerous. The sheets were stained and carpet worn and dirty. The fridge made loud noises all night. You only have control of the fan and on/off for the air con. So we either had to be freezing cold or boiling hot. The walls/doors/windows were paper thin. We could hear every ounce of street noise (even on 9th floor) and every sound and movement that other guests made. When another guest used the plumbing, you could hear it loud and clear in the room. If another guest was having a normal convo in the hall, it sounded like they were right in the room with you. This hotel is in terrible condition and terrible value. We paid almost the same price for the same type of room on the same day of the week a block up and it was a thousand times better than the Pacific Hotel. I’m normally a generous rater, but the only nice thing I can say about this place is the location is good. Definitely not worth the money we paid and so many better options nearby.
